How to Install and Uninstall sane-utils Package on Ubuntu 20.10 (Groovy Gorilla)

Last updated: April 28,2024

1. Install "sane-utils" package

Please follow the guidelines below to install sane-utils on Ubuntu 20.10 (Groovy Gorilla)

$ sudo apt update $ sudo apt install sane-utils

2. Uninstall "sane-utils" package

Please follow the guidance below to uninstall sane-utils on Ubuntu 20.10 (Groovy Gorilla):

$ sudo apt remove sane-utils $ sudo apt autoclean && sudo apt autoremove

Description-en: API library for scanners -- utilities
SANE stands for "Scanner Access Now Easy" and is an application
programming interface (API) that provides standardized access to any
raster image scanner hardware (flatbed scanner, hand-held scanner,
video- and still-cameras, frame-grabbers, etc.). The SANE standard is
free and its discussion and development are open to everybody. The
current source code is written to support several operating systems,
including GNU/Linux, OS/2, Win32 and various Unices and is available
under the GNU General Public License (commercial applications and
backends are welcome, too, however).
.
This package includes the command line frontend scanimage, the saned
server and the sane-find-scanner utility, along with their documentation.
